Because of the economic effectiveness and efficiencies, steam injection with horizontal wells is applied more broadly now. However, due to the complexity of horizontal wellbore trajectory and the influence of high temperature, there are a large number of casing damages in the process of steam injection, which has seriously affected the normal oil field operation. So, it is of great significance for the completion designing and production method chosen to find out the main reasons for casing damage, and propose effective preventive measures.Firstly, based on the common structure of completion strings and the project horizontal well trajectory data, the paper set up the friction drag model, with which we calculate the frictional drags and the axial forces of the horizontal completion strings in the tripping process. In the analysis, abnormal wellbore trajectory and dogleg both are also involved. Secondly, analyze the heat transfer characteristics of the wellbore and then carry out numerical simulations of the wellbore by using the finite element analysis software ANSYS. To the vertical section, this paper analyzes the influence of different apparent heat conductivities of insulated tubing and the thermal recovery packer failure. To the horizontal section, time of the steam injection cycle is considered to find its influence on the wellbore temperature field. Finally, based on the calculated results of the vertical section temperature field, we can get thermal stresses and check the vertical casings. And we also check the horizontal casings by calculating the stresses and deformations in many conditions to find out the main cause of casing damage, such as in the general condition, shale collapse and wellbore trajectory suffered depressions.etc.On basis of the above theoretical analysis and combined with the requirements from oilfield actual operations, this paper proposes many preventive measures and protection methods for horizontal steam injection wells casing damages, which is expected to provide some guidance in oilfield practice.
